Does Blenheim Road or North Ryde have better schools?

On average school ICSEA (the ACARA index that benchmarks educational advantage), Blenheim Road scores 1123 vs 1098 in North Ryde. ICSEA is a school-community indicator, not a quality rating, so always check NAPLAN results and catchment boundaries for the specific address you're considering.

Which is more walkable, Blenheim Road or North Ryde?

Blenheim Road scores 48/100 on walkability vs 40/100. Above 70 is considered very walkable (most errands on foot), 50-69 is walkable for some errands, below 50 typically requires a car for daily life.
